How to Tuesday - herbal infusions

I do so like to imbibe strange green concoctions. This is something I started doing recently.  Having herbal infusions.  It's different than herbal tea because it's made with lots of herbs, lots of water, and it steeps for at least 4 hours.  I make them in the morning, and drink them late in the afternoon. 

And this is how:

Herbs and mason jar
All you need is herbs, a mason jar, and boiling water.
My favorite infusion is a blend of nettles and oatstraw.
Sometimes I add a pinch of elder berries if I feel a sniffle coming on.

One ounce herbs to one quart water
One ounce of herbs to one quart of boiling water.

Seal and let sit for at least 4 hours
Lid it, and let it sit for at least 4 hours.

Strain the leaves and such
Strain the leaves.

squeeze out the liquid
Squeeze out the last bit of liquid.
